(3) Mean braking torque with one size bigger capacity
In a standard combination of a motor and an inverter, the braking torque is limited by the
overcurrent strength of the inverter. However, by increasing the rank of the inverter, you
can use the maximum torque of the motor.
Table 9.3 shows the braking torques of the inverters whose capacity is increased by one.
The motor capacity must be raised when 135% or more braking is required.
